Directions

Middletown run - 135 miles
3 hrs 21 min not counting stops

----------------------------------------
Meet at Texas Road House parking lot,
3333 N.Texas, Fairfield
09:00 a.m. Leave parking lot head N
.5 Get on Hwy 80 West (1.8)
2.3 Take Waterman exit (1.9)
4.2 Becomes Mankas Corner Rd (2.8)
7.0 Right on Suisun Vly Rd (2.4)
9.4 Becomes Wooden Vly Rd (6.7)
16.1 Rht on Monticello/Hwy 121 N(5.5)
21.6 Left on Hwy 128 NW (.1)
21.7 Right into Moskowitz corner
[rest stop]

Back on Hwy 128 NW (4.7)
26.4 Right on Knoxville Rd (13.0)
39.4 Stop at bridge at Pope Canyon Rd

Left on Pope Canyon Rd (8.4)
47.8 Right on Pope Vly Cross (1.0)
48.8 Right on Chiles Pope Vly (4.6)
(Becomes just Pope Vly Rd)
53.4 Right on Butts Canyon Rd (14.6)
68.0 Left on Hwy 29 S (1.3)
69.3 [lunch at Perry's Deli]

Back up Hwy 29 N (.8)
70.1 [gas stop]

Contine N on Hwy 29(.4)
70.5 Right on Butts Canyon Rd (14.7)
85.2 Bear left on Pope Vly (12.3)
Becomes Chiles Pope Vly Rd
Stay on Pope Vly,
passed Pope Cnyn Rd)
97.5 Bear Rt stay Chile Pope Vly (3.6)
101.1 Bear left on Hwy 128 (12.2)
113.3 Left on Steele Canyon Rd into
Moskowitz corner for rest stop

113.4 Right on Hwy 121 (5.5)
118.9 Left on Wooden Vly Rd (6.6)
125.5 Becomes Suisun Vly Rd (9.5)
135.0 And to home

Description and Highlights

This is a short run. I would call it a
practice run or a shake down run.
The turns are many, & not overly tight.
Traffic often slows the speeds, but if
by yourself, you can spurt by them and
continue at your desired pace.
The start on Wooden Vly Rd along with
Monticello Rd has the tightest turns of
the day and some of the steepest hills.
Once on Hwy 128, the road straightens
somewhat and widens, allowing for higher
speeds and relaxed cruising.
The turn onto Knoxville Rd take us to
Lake Berryessa. Great views of the
lake, but often with trailered boats
in the way.
After a stop just passed the bridge, we
head up Pope Canyon Rd.
Here the hills will lightly test your
brakes and braking skills.
Then it is on to Pope Vly Rd and Butts
Canyon Rd. Both can be taken at speed
or at a relaxed pace joyously.
Lunch is in Middletown at the deli
though others may enjoy Cowpoke Cafe.
The way back is along the same roads,
though we take Chiles Vly rather than
Pope Canyon to Knoxville.
